From 905282b7846358c30058a35303161146317b8931 Mon Sep 17 00:00:00 2001 From: Stephan Linz Date: Mon, 18 Apr 2011 22:45:42 +0200 Subject: [PATCH 6/9] Add support for XMEGA arch and devices Add support for the AVR XMEGA family of devices, a new architectures (groupings), device names, and support for new opcodes that are used in this family. This is the patch that has been used out in the field in several AVR toolchain distributions successfully for a long time. Instruction set avr6 is for the enhanced AVR core with a 3-byte PC (MCU types: atmega2560, atmega2561). +Instruction set avrxmega2 is for the XMEGA AVR core with 8K to 64K program +memory space and less than 64K data space (MCU types: atxmega16a4, atxmega16d4, +atxmega32d4). + +Instruction set avrxmega3 is for the XMEGA AVR core with 8K to 64K program +memory space and greater than 64K data space (MCU types: atxmega32a4). + +Instruction set avrxmega4 is for the XMEGA AVR core with up to 64K program +memory space and less than 64K data space (MCU types: atxmega64a3, atxmega64d3). + +Instruction set avrxmega5 is for the XMEGA AVR core with up to 64K program +memory space and greater than 64K data space (MCU types: atxmega64a1). + +Instruction set avrxmega6 is for the XMEGA AVR core with up to 256K program +memory space and less than 64K data space (MCU types: atxmega128a3, +atxmega128d3, atxmega192a3, atxmega192d3, atxmega256a3, atxmega256a3b, +atxmega192d3). + +Instruction set avrxmega7 is for the XMEGA AVR core with up to 256K program +memory space and greater than 64K data space (MCU types: atxmega128a1). + @cindex @code{-mall-opcodes} command line option, AVR @item
